SMBus access functions assume that 16-bit values are formatted as
little endian numbers. The direct i2c access functions in regmap,
however, assume that 16-bit values are formatted as big endian numbers.
As a result, the current code returns different values if an i2c chip's
16-bit registers are accessed through i2c access functions vs. SMBus
access functions.
Use regmap_smbus_read_word_swapped and regmap_smbus_write_word_swapped
for 16-bit SMBus accesses if a chip is configured as REGMAP_ENDIAN_BIG.
If the chip is configured as REGMAP_ENDIAN_LITTLE, keep using
regmap_smbus_write_word_data and regmap_smbus_read_word_data. Otherwise
reject registration if the controller does not support direct i2c accesses.

While the filesystem labeling method is only printed at the KERN_DEBUG
level, this still appears in dmesg and on modern Linux distributions
that create a lot of tmpfs mounts for session handling, the dmesg can
easily be filled with a lot of "SELinux: initialized (dev X ..."
messages. This patch removes this notification for the normal case
but leaves the error message intact (displayed when mounting a
filesystem with an unknown labeling behavior).

If we're using NFSv4.1, then we have the ability to let the server know
whether or not we believe that returning a delegation as part of our OPEN
request would be useful.
The feature needs to be used with care, since the client sending the request
doesn't necessarily know how other clients are using that file, and how
they may be affected by the delegation.
For this reason, our initial use of the feature will be to let the server
know when the client believes that handing out a delegation would not be
useful.
The first application for this function is when opening the file using
O_DIRECT.

Sending data in high speed then introducing a busoff results
in spurious BUS_ERROR events from the USBCan-II firmware directly
_after_ the triggered BUS_OFF event.
In the current CAN state handling code, this will lead to an
invalid can state of ACTIVE, ERROR, or PASSIVE even though the
CAN controller has been already shut down due to the busoff.
Guard the state handling code from such invalid events.

A race issue has been observed with the encoder-tpd12s015 driver, which
leads to errors when trying to read EDID. This has only now been
observed, as OMAP4 and OMAP5 boards used SoC's GPIOs for LS_OE GPIO. On
dra7-evm boards, the LS_OE is behind a i2c controlled GPIO expander,
which increases the time to set the LS_OE.
This patch simplifies the handling of the LS_OE gpio in the driver by
removing the interrupt handling totally. The only time we actually need
to enable LS_OE is when we are reading the EDID, and thus we can just
set and clear the LS_OE gpio inside the read_edid() function.
This also has the additional benefit of very slightly decreasing the
power consumption.
